The Man-Hater, A Song by Henry Carey

What’s Man, but a perfidious Creature,
Of an inconstant, fickle Nature,
Deceitful, and Conceited too,
Boasting of more than he can do?

Beware, ye heedless Nymphs, beware,
For Men will Lye, and Fawn, and Swear;
But, when they once have gain’d the Prize,
Good Heav’ns! How they will Tyranize!

From: http://rpo.library.utoronto.ca/poems/man-hater-song

Date: 1713

By: Henry Carey (c1687-1743)
